Trump says minerals deal to be signed next Thursday after Ukraine talks
FILE PHOTO: U.S. President Donald Trump meets with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skiy at the White House in Washington, D.C., U.S., February 28, 2025. REUTERS/Brian Snyder/File Photo
WASHINGTON (Reuters) - President Donald Trump said on Thursday that the U.S. would sign a new minerals deal next Thursday, in an apparent reference to talks with Ukraine.
